It's a 3 valve/ qev air gun, the tank gets filled through the schraeder valve, the airhose attachment is a pilot valve to open the quick exhaust valve to dump all the air out of the tank and out the pipe.

I've had good results with denim and wood glue, you have to stretch it and tack/pin it in place the wrap it as tightly as you can with a bandage as a clamp. I just wrapped a merbau board today

Brad Simms recommends 100 pushups, 100 sit ups and 100 body weight squats a day to get bigger hops. I did them spaced out throughout the day, 10 at a time of each and it made a huge difference after only a few weeks. Just remember at 40 your muscles will be strong but all your tendons and ligaments are gonna be easy to hurt so take it easy

Bit of an update, got some minor compression fractures when trying for a full draw and had to retiller down to about 30lb at 28 inches. Shoots exceptionally smooth and hits way harder than ot has any right to. At 15 metres I'm hitting repeated head shots on a 3d rabbit shooting homemade pine arrows with some cheap bodkin points. Bought a decent merbau board to try something a bit denser to see if my denim backing will hold a properly weighted hunting bow.
